Indiana schools chief Glenda Ritz to make campaign announcement

INDIANAPOLIS (AP) — Democratic Indiana schools Superintendent Glenda Ritz, who has said she’s considering a run for governor, is expected to make a campaign announcement this week.

Ritz’s campaign Facebook page posted a series of messages Sunday saying she would make a “special campaign announcement” Thursday at Ben Davis High School in Indianapolis. The posts didn’t give any further details. Announcements also were planned for Terre Haute and Evansville later Thursday and in Fort Wayne, South Bend and Hammond on Friday, according to the page.

Ritz earlier this year said she was considering running for governor. She couldn’t immediately be reached for comment Sunday.

She would join a Democratic field that already includes former Indiana House Speaker and 2012 nominee John Gregg and state Sen. Karen Tallian of Portage.
